Sanskriti Sangam Cultural Fest Celebrated with Great Fervor at Don Bosco College Yadgir

The Don Bosco College Auditorium was abuzz with energy and enthusiasm as the Sanskriti Sangam Cultural Fest was inaugurated on July 20, 2024. The event was graced by the presence of Fr. Saji Anachalil SDB, Rector and Manager of Don Bosco institutions Yadgir, as the chief guest.

Dr. Manjunath, a renowned scholar, was the special guest of honor. The festival saw the participation of around 300 people, including students, faculty members, and staff.

The event was skillfully coordinated by the Principal of the college, Fr. Augustine, Vice Principal, Fr. Jith and student representatives. The festival showcased a vibrant display of music, dance, and drama, highlighting the rich cultural heritage of India.

The inauguration ceremony began with a grand procession, followed by a welcome address by Fr. Augustine. Fr. Saji Anachalil SDB, in his inaugural speech, emphasized the importance of cultural festivals in promoting unity and harmony.

Dr. Manjunath, in his keynote address, stressed the need to preserve and promote our cultural heritage. The festival featured a range of cultural programs, including traditional dances, music performances, and skits.

The event concluded with a vote of thanks by the student representative, followed by a grand finale performance. The Sanskriti Sangam Cultural Fest was a resounding success, and the Don Bosco College community looks forward to many more such events in the future.
